Twilight of the Dragon and the Witch
In the ancient mountains of the Eastern Empire, where the whispers of the dragon and the lament of the witch were said to be the heartbeat of the land, there lay a village shrouded in the mists of time. The village was known for its serene beauty, but its peace was a fragile illusion.
Liu Qing, a young dragon warrior, had grown up in the shadows of the mountains, his life a tapestry of martial arts training and the tales of the dragon's roar. His father, a legendary warrior, had vanished without a trace when Liu was but a child, leaving behind only a single, cryptic message: "The dragon's roar awakens the witch's lament."
As Liu grew, so did his prowess in the martial arts, and he was soon recognized as a prodigy among his peers. Yet, the enigma of his father's disappearance remained, a dark cloud hanging over his life. One fateful day, while meditating atop a craggy peak, Liu heard the dragon's roar echo through the heavens. It was a sound that resonated deep within his soul, calling him to adventure.
In the depths of the forest, Liu encountered the witch, a woman with eyes like pools of ancient wisdom and hair that cascaded like a waterfall of midnight. She was known as Lian, the Witch of the Enchanted Grove, and her lament was a haunting melody that only those with a heart heavy with sorrow could hear.
Lian had her own tale of woe. Once a revered sorceress, she had been betrayed by her closest companions, who sought to harness her powers for their own gain. In the process, she had been cursed, her magic bound to a single, ancient artifact. Now, she wandered the forest, her lament a silent plea for redemption.
The two met under the shadow of a towering willow, its branches swaying to the rhythm of the wind. Liu, sensing a kinship with the witch, offered his aid in her quest to break the curse. Lian, in turn, revealed the existence of a dark force that threatened to consume the world. It was a force that had once been a guardian of the land, but had since been corrupted by ambition and greed.
Together, Liu and Lian set out on a perilous journey, their path lined with trials that tested their strength, their resolve, and their trust in one another. They faced off against shadowy assassins, each more cunning than the last, and navigated treacherous landscapes that seemed to conspire against them.
As they ventured deeper into the heart of the Empire, Liu discovered that the dark force was being manipulated by a traitor within the Dragon Order, the martial arts sect that had trained him. His own master, the one who had guided him since childhood, was revealed to be the architect of the corruption that threatened to engulf the land.
The revelation struck Liu with a heavy blow. He had been trained to protect the world, yet he had been blind to the truth that lay within his own ranks. His heart was torn between his loyalty to the Dragon Order and his newfound friendship with Lian.
The climax of their journey came in the heart of the Empire, where the dark force was strongest. Liu and Lian, now joined by a few loyal allies, faced the traitor and the corrupted guardian in a battle that would determine the fate of the world.
The battle was fierce, a dance of life and death, as Liu and Lian fought with all their might. Liu's dragon essence clashed with the guardian's dark aura, and Lian's lament mingled with Liu's roar, creating a symphony of power and sorrow.
In the end, it was Liu's unwavering resolve and Lian's ancient magic that triumphed. The guardian was banished, and the traitor was unmasked and vanquished. The curse on Lian was lifted, and her lament was no more.
But the victory came at a cost. Liu's master, the one who had raised him, was killed in the fray. Liu stood over the body of his mentor, his heart heavy with grief and betrayal.
As he turned to Lian, she reached out a hand to him. "You have proven your worth, Liu Qing," she said, her voice laced with compassion. "Your father would be proud."
With the dark force defeated and the Empire safe once more, Liu and Lian stood together, their bond forged in the crucible of war and betrayal. They were a testament to the power of friendship, even in the face of the darkest times.
The dragon's roar and the witch's lament had been the whispers of fate, guiding Liu and Lian to their destinies. And though the journey was fraught with pain and loss, it had also brought forth redemption and hope.
In the twilight of the dragon and the witch, a new era began, one marked by unity and the promise of a future where the roar of the dragon and the lament of the witch would be heard as the song of a world reborn.
